diff options
| author | Eric W. Biederman <ebiederm@xmission.com> | 2015-09-15 21:03:53 -0400 |
|---|---|---|
| committer | David S. Miller <davem@davemloft.net> | 2015-09-17 20:18:32 -0400 |
| commit | 5a70649e0dae02ba5090540fffce667d2300bc5a (patch) | |
| tree | 38e18ea126c7665eebaf3ff3231a43522929a115 /net/decnet | |
| parent | a6568b2425daffc7b21ae63b6601b57ae14b5cb8 (diff) | |
net: Merge dst_output and dst_output_sk
Add a sock paramter to dst_output making dst_output_sk superfluous.
Add a skb->sk parameter to all of the callers of dst_output
Have the callers of dst_output_sk call dst_output.
Signed-off-by: "Eric W. Biederman" <ebiederm@xmission.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'net/decnet')
| -rw-r--r-- | net/decnet/dn_nsp_out.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/net/decnet/dn_nsp_out.c b/net/decnet/dn_nsp_out.c index 1aaa51ebbda6..4b02dd300f50 100644 --- a/net/decnet/dn_nsp_out.c +++ b/net/decnet/dn_nsp_out.c | |||
| @@ -85,7 +85,7 @@ static void dn_nsp_send(struct sk_buff *skb) | |||
| 85 | if (dst) { | 85 | if (dst) { |
| 86 | try_again: | 86 | try_again: |
| 87 | skb_dst_set(skb, dst); | 87 | skb_dst_set(skb, dst); |
| 88 | dst_output(skb); | 88 | dst_output(skb->sk, skb); |
| 89 | return; | 89 | return; |
| 90 | } | 90 | } |
| 91 | 91 | ||
| @@ -582,7 +582,7 @@ static __inline__ void dn_nsp_do_disc(struct sock *sk, unsigned char msgflg, | |||
| 582 | * associations. | 582 | * associations. |
| 583 | */ | 583 | */ |
| 584 | skb_dst_set(skb, dst_clone(dst)); | 584 | skb_dst_set(skb, dst_clone(dst)); |
| 585 | dst_output(skb); | 585 | dst_output(skb->sk, skb); |
| 586 | } | 586 | } |
| 587 | 587 | ||
| 588 | 588 | ||
